https://jo.my/le58ll Respiratory Protection & Airborne Hazards: Keep It Clean, Keep It Safe Let's talk about something you don't see—but definitely feel. Airborne hazards. Dust. Fumes. Mists. Vapors. The stuff that hangs in the air and messes with your lungs if you're not protected. That's where your respirator comes in. But a respirator's only as good as the condition it's in. Week 4 is all about Cleaning, Storage, and Responsibility when it comes to respiratory protection. We're not just throwing on a mask and calling it good. You've got to take care of your gear if you want it to take care of you. Here are a few things to lock in when dealing with respirators on the floor: 1. Clean it after each use. Sweat, dust, oils—your respirator collects a lot during the day. Always clean it according to the manufacturer's instructions. Use mild soap and warm water. Skip the harsh chemicals. They'll damage the material and reduce protection. 2. Store it the right way. Don't toss it in your locker or throw it on a dusty shelf—store respirators in a sealed container or bag. Keep them dry, away from direct sunlight, chemicals, or anything that might cause contamination or damage. 3. Replace filters regularly. You'll know when it's time. Breathing starts to feel harder, or you're catching more odors than usual. Don't wait until you're gasping—swap filters out based on the schedule your facility recommends, or sooner if needed. 4. Check your gear—every time. Before each use, do a quick check. Look for cracks, dry rot, worn straps, or missing valves. If something feels off—it probably is. Please don't use it. 5. Take foul gear out of the game. If a respirator is damaged, expired, or in any way—tag it, report it, and remove it from service. No exceptions. As always, these are potential tips. Please be sure to follow the rules and regulations of your specific facility. Respiratory protection isn't just about what you wear—it's how you care for it. A clean, well-maintained respirator means you're getting the whole level of protection every time you put it on. It means fewer health risks and more time getting the job done right. A strong Safety Culture depends on personal responsibility. That means keeping your gear clean, storing it safely, and replacing it when needed. Just after 8:00 pm on the evening of February 19, 1994, thirty-one-year-old Gloria Ramirez was admitted to Riverside General Hospital with what Emergency Room staff believed were symptoms of a heart attack. When Ramirez failed to respond to the medications and emergency treatments, medical staff began preparations for defibrillation; however, when they removed the woman's shirt, they were surprised to find her skin covered in an oily sheen and her body seemed to be emitting an odd fruity odor. Stranger still, when a nurse took a blood sample from the woman's arm, the blood smelled of ammonia and appeared to have slightly yellow particles floating in it. The nurse turned to leave the room, intending to take the sample for immediate analysis, but she didn't even make it to the door before she lost consciousness and was caught by a coworker before her limp body hit the floor. Less than an hour after she was admitted to the Riverside General Emergency Room, Gloria Ramirez was pronounced dead, but her story was far from over.Within hours of Ramirez's visit to the ER, medical personnel who attended her that evening became sick with symptoms typically associated with insecticide poisoning (tremors, apnea, burning skin), and several required hospitalization. https://jo.my/r1ywgu Respiratory Protection & Airborne Hazards: Choosing the Right Type of Respirator Airborne hazards in a warehouse aren't always obvious. You might not see or smell them, but they're there. Dust from pallet handling. Vapors from cleaning supplies. Fumes from battery charging areas. Each hazard is different, and so is the protection you need against it. One of the top priorities of a solid Safety Culture is making sure people understand that not all respirators are the same. The type of respirator you choose must match the hazard you're facing. Using the wrong one is almost the same as using none at all. Here are a few ways to make sure you're using the proper protection: Match the respirator to the hazard. Paper dust masks may keep out nuisance dust, but they won't protect you from chemical vapors. A cartridge respirator that handles solvents won't block welding fumes. Always confirm that the respirator you're issued is designed for the exact task you're doing. Know the difference between air-purifying and supplied-air models. Air-purifying respirators filter the air around you. They work when the air has oxygen but contains contaminants. Supplied-air respirators bring in clean air from another source. Those are used when the surrounding air isn't safe to breathe at all. Pay attention to filter ratings. You've heard terms like N95 or P100. Those labels matter. They tell you how much filtration you're getting. N95 filters block at least 95 percent of airborne particles, while P100 filters block nearly all of them. Choose the one that meets the level of hazard. Only use a Self-contained Breathing Apparatus with proper training. Self-contained breathing apparatus, or SCBAs, provide complete independence from the surrounding air. They're life-saving in the right situations, but they're also complex. No one should ever use one without complete training and certification. Never share or modify respirators. Respirators are personal protective equipment, just like earplugs or gloves. Sharing one spreads germs and may cause a bad fit. Modifying one, such as taping cracks or adding parts, can make it unsafe. If it's damaged, replace it. As always, these are potential tips. Please be sure to follow the rules and regulations of your specific facility. Respirators protect one of your most vital organs: your lungs. But they only work if they're the right kind, in good condition, and used the way they were meant to be. Warehouse air can look fine but still carry invisible hazards.
